The State University of New York (SUNY) at New Paltz welcomes applications for the role of Complex Director in the department of Residence Life. This appointment is a ten-month, live-in position, which includes excellent state and union benefits, a furnished apartment, and meal plan. The Complex Director reports directly to an Area Coordinator of Residence Life. The successful applicant will supervise and coordinate the activities of one residence hall and serve on a functional team within the department. They will be responsible for the operation of one residence hall of not more than 300 students, as well as specialized departmental responsibilities for a residential program housing approximately 3,000 students.

Responsibilities of the role include, but are not limited to:

  • Directly supervise the Resident Assistants in the building which you are assigned. Provide training, development, support, and conduct evaluations of staff

  • Oversee the development and coordination of community development, which includes cultural, educational and social programs for the hall, thus addressing the needs and concerns of the community

  • Counsel and advise individual students in the broad areas of academic, vocational, and personal guidance. Provide training and data to staff to facilitate their ability to provide counseling within the limits of their trained capabilities

  • Actively advise a hall government and assist them by developing programs that enhance their leadership development

  • Serve as a member of a departmental functional team - Administrative Operations, Leadership Development, Program Development, Assessment, Advancement, or Judicial

  • Assist in the recruitment and selection of new professional and paraprofessional staff

  • Consistently enforce Federal, State and College regulations within the hall and across campus

  • Assist in the development and accomplishment of goals and priorities for the Division of Student Affairs and the Department of Residence Life

  • Participate in an on-call rotation schedule, providing 24 hour support to students and responding to on-campus crises and/or incidents

  • Any and all additional tasks and responsibilities as deemed necessary and appropriate by the Director of Residence Life

  • Complex Directors will also be required to support on-campus efforts related to the health and safety of our students during crisis scenarios including but not limited to severe weather, pandemic and health crisis, facilities issues, and other emergency scenarios.

Qualifications

Required:

  • Bachelor's Degree

  • Demonstrated ability to develop and implement residence hall programming, community building, and in-service training for staff

  • Evidence of strong administrative skills, ability to multitask

  • Demonstrated ability to interact and work well with staff and students of diverse interests and backgrounds

Preferred:

  • Master's degree

  • Relevant hall experience
